How to read like a historian: transmission vs. transaction, read multiple times, active reading, ask questions, write notes, look up words, make connections with other readings/lectures, note word choices. If the wife of a man be taken lying with another man, they shall bind them and throw them into the water. If the husband of a woman spares the life of his wife, the king shall spare the life of his subject. If he destroy the eye of another man, they shall destroy his eye. If he breaks a man"s bone, they shall break his bone. If he destroy the eye of a common man or break a bone of a common man, he shall pay one mana of silver.
